单选题

下面程序的输出结果为多少?

发布于 2022-03-02 15:50:59

下面程序在 32 位机器上的输出结果为多少?
#include <stdio.h>
#include <string.h>
void Func(char str_arg[100]) { printf("%d\n", sizeof(str_arg)) }
int main(void) {
    char str[] = "Hello"
    printf("%d\n", sizeof(str))
    printf("%d\n", strlen(str))
    char *p = str
    printf("%d\n", sizeof(p))
    Func(str)
}


登录后免费查看答案
关注者
0
被浏览
14
知识点
面圈网VIP题库

面圈网VIP题库全新上线,海量真题题库资源。 90大类考试,超10万份考试真题开放下载啦

去下载看看